Prehospital Tourniquets in Civilians: A Systematic Review

Summary
Prehospital tourniquet use for severe extremity bleeding in civilians appears to improve survival rates and reduce blood transfusions. While evidence quality is low, findings consistently suggest benefits with few transient adverse effects.
Area of Science:
- Emergency Medicine
- Trauma Surgery
- Public Health
Background:
- Civilian mass-casualty events and terrorist attacks frequently cause uncontrollable extremity bleeding.
- Prehospital tourniquet application is increasingly adopted in civilian settings for life-threatening hemorrhages.
Purpose of the Study:
- To systematically review and summarize existing literature on prehospital tourniquet use in civilian settings.
- To assess the impact of tourniquet use on survival rates in patients with critical extremity hemorrhage.
Main Methods:
- A systematic literature review was conducted following PRISMA guidelines.
- Searches included Medline, Embase, Cochrane Library, and Epistemonikos up to January 2019.
- Studies published after January 1, 2000, examining prehospital tourniquet use were included.
Main Results:
- 55 studies were identified from 3,460 screened records, exhibiting high heterogeneity and low evidence quality.
- Most studies indicated increased survival in the tourniquet group, though precise benefit estimation was challenging.
- Reduced need for blood transfusions was commonly reported, alongside few, mostly transient, adverse effects.
Conclusions:
- Despite limitations in evidence quality, prehospital tourniquet use in civilian settings for life-threatening extremity hemorrhage is consistently associated with improved survival.
- Tourniquet application appears to reduce the need for blood transfusions.
- Adverse effects associated with tourniquet use are generally minimal and transient.
